学习进阶视角下数据观念的内涵和落实——基于澳大利亚RMFII研究项目的经验和反思

数据观念是数学核心素养在初中学段九个具体表现之一,主要涉及统计与概率内容.厘清数据观念的内涵和落实策略是实现以核心素养为导向的初中统计与概率教学的关键问题.澳大利亚RMFII项目以由变异、分布、期望、随机性和非形式化推断整合而成的三个统计大概念为进阶变量,通过实证手段建立了澳大利亚初中生对统计与概率的认识与理解从简单到复杂、从低水平到高水平、含8个分区的统计推理学习进阶.在阐述和分析该学习进阶构建方法和成果应用的基础上,对我国数据观念的可操作性定义、数据观念和统计与概率具体知识内容之间的联系、数据观念测评工具和教学资源的开发等问题进行了反思和讨论.为明晰数据观念的内涵,需通过实证方法建立数据观念的学习进阶.利用该学习进阶,一方面可以评估学生在数据观念上的表现,另一方面可以开发有针对性的教学资源和教师培训素材,促进数据观念在课堂教学中的有效落实.
The Connotation and Implementation of Data Sense from the Perspective of Learning Progression——Experiences from and Reflections on the Australian RMFII Research Project
Data sense is one of the nine specific manifestations of mathematical core competencies in the junior high school stage,mainly concerning the content area of statistics and probability.The essence and implementation of data sense are crucial to achieving core competency oriented teaching of junior high school statistics and probability.The Australia RMFII research project has constructed statistical reasoning learning progression that characterizes the development of middle school students'understanding and comprehension of statistics and probability,evolving from simplicity to complexity and from lower to higher levels with eight zones,using empirical approaches.This progression takes three big ideas in statistics as progression variables,encapsulating key concepts including variation,distribution,expectation,randomness and informal inferences.Based on an in-depth analysis of the methods and applications of statistical reasoning learning progression within the RMFII project in Australia,this paper discusses about and reflects upon relevant issues within our context,which include the operational definition of data sense,the connections between data sense and specific topics within statistics and probability,and the development of assessment tools and instructional resources for data sense.To clarify the conceptualization of data sense,it is essential to establish a learning progression for data sense through empirical methods.By applying this learning progression,the performance of students in data sense can be assessed.Moreover,targeted teaching resources and materials for teacher professional development can be developed to facilitate the effective implementation of data sense in classroom teaching.
